What Is the Integrated Chinese 1 Textbook?
Integrated Chinese 1 is the first volume in a multi-level series designed specifically for
learners who want to acquire Mandarin Chinese in a structured and progressive manner.
Published by Cheng & Tsui, the series is known for its balanced approach that combines
language fundamentals with cultural insights. The "1" level typically corresponds to an
introductory course, making it ideal for absolute beginners or those with minimal
exposure to Mandarin.
This textbook is part of a larger curriculum package that often includes workbooks,
character workbooks, audio CDs or digital audio files, and online resources, providing a
holistic learning experience. The content is carefully curated to cover speaking, listening,
reading, and writing skills, which are essential for mastering Chinese.

Comprehensive Language Skills Development
The textbook doesn’t just focus on vocabulary and grammar in isolation. Instead, it
integrates listening exercises, dialogues, and character practice into thematic lessons. For
example, a single chapter might introduce new words related to family or school, then
present a dialogue using those words, followed by writing practice for essential Chinese
characters. This integrated approach helps learners see the practical use of language
immediately.
Emphasis on Chinese Characters and Pinyin
Chinese characters can be intimidating for beginners, but the Integrated Chinese 1
textbook introduces them gradually, alongside Pinyin—the romanization system that
shows pronunciation. This dual focus ensures learners not only recognize characters but
also know how to pronounce them correctly, laying a solid foundation for future fluency.

Consistent Practice of Characters
Chinese characters require regular practice to memorize their strokes and meanings. Use
the character workbook or create flashcards to review daily. Writing characters by hand
helps reinforce memory and improves your writing skills.
Listening and Speaking Repetition
Mandarin tones can be tricky, so listening to audio components of the textbook repeatedly
is crucial. Try shadowing the dialogues—listening and repeating aloud to mimic
pronunciation and intonation. This method boosts your speaking confidence and listening
comprehension.

Strengths of the Integrated Chinese 1 Textbook
One of the most notable strengths of the Integrated Chinese 1 textbook is its
comprehensive coverage of beginner-level Mandarin. The textbook covers approximately
300 Chinese characters, a solid foundation for elementary proficiency. Its structured
progression ensures that learners build vocabulary and grammar systematically, reducing
the risk of feeling overwhelmed.
Additionally, the inclusion of audio materials is a significant asset. Listening to native
speakers enhances pronunciation and intonation skills, which are critical in tonal
languages like Mandarin. The dialogues are recorded by native speakers, ensuring
authentic exposure.

Comparisons with Other Mandarin Textbooks
When compared to other popular Mandarin textbooks such as “New Practical Chinese
Reader” or “Chinese Made Easy,” Integrated Chinese 1 tends to emphasize a balance
between traditional and modern language usage. Its systematic approach to character
writing and stroke order is more detailed than some alternatives, which may gloss over
these aspects in favor of conversational skills.
New Practical Chinese Reader, for instance, is often praised for its engaging storylines and
multimedia integration but can be more challenging for self-learners due to its fast pace.
Integrated Chinese 1, by contrast, is sometimes regarded as more classroom-friendly,
with clearly delineated lesson objectives and incremental difficulty.
Chinese Made Easy offers a more simplified approach suitable for younger learners or
casual students, whereas Integrated Chinese 1 caters to serious learners aiming for
academic rigor.
Potential Limitations and Considerations
While Integrated Chinese 1 boasts numerous advantages, it is not without limitations.
Some users report that the textbook’s pace may be slow for learners with prior exposure
to Mandarin or those seeking rapid conversational proficiency. The heavy focus on written
characters, while essential for literacy, can be daunting for learners primarily interested in
speaking and listening skills.
Additionally, the textbook’s design and examples lean toward formal and academic
contexts, which may not always reflect colloquial or regional variations of spoken Chinese.
Learners aiming for conversational fluency in specific dialects or informal settings might
need supplementary materials.
The cost factor is another consideration. As a comprehensive package often bundled with
workbooks, audio CDs, and online access, the total expense can be higher than some
alternative resources, potentially limiting accessibility for budget-conscious learners.
